Save Your Strands
Any stylist will tell you not to expose your hair to heat without prepping it with a heat protector. Wella EIMI Thermal Image Heat Protection Spray ($18) creates a shield of sorts between your locks and your trusted iron or dryer to prevent split ends and dry hair.

Can't-Live-Without-Co-Wash
When time is of the essence, reach for a co-cleanser that does the job of a shampoo and conditioner in a single step. We’re partial to SheaMoisture Coconut & Hibiscus Co-Wash Conditioning Cleanser ($12), a natural-based one that lends itself to serious cleansing without stripping much-needed oil from your hair.
